Dysart Taylor is pleased to announce director John F. Wilcox, Jr. and of counsel attorney Anne Lindner Saghir obtained summary judgment for their client, a state transportation department, in a personal injury case involving a motorcycle crash.

In 2018, the plaintiff was involved in a motorcycle crash while entering a truck stop/gas station. The plaintiff’s motorcycle was struck by a work truck in the process of leaving the property, and then he sued the truck stop, its employee driver and the department of transportation.

The Dysart Taylor team defended the transportation department against claims of negligent design and maintenance at the station. Specifically, the motorcyclist claimed the department failed to ensure the driveway throat length leading from the highway provided for an adequate space for incoming and outgoing traffic that eventually caused or contributed to cause the accident.

Wilcox and Saghir successfully defended their client by establishing that it did not own or exercise control over the area where the accident occurred. In January 2022, the Circuit Court judge agreed and granted Wilcox and Saghir’s motion for summary judgement, ruling that as a matter of law, none of the exceptions to sovereign immunity were applicable.
